[git patches] libata fixes

From: Jeff Garzik
Date: Wed Aug 15 2007 - 05:45:18 EST



Please pull from 'upstream-linus' branch of
master.kernel.org:/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jgarzik/libata-dev.git upstream-linus

to receive the following updates:

drivers/ata/ata_piix.c | 9 ++++++++-
drivers/ata/libata-core.c | 2 +-
drivers/ata/pata_artop.c | 19 ++++++++++++++-----
drivers/ata/pata_hpt37x.c | 20 +++++++++-----------
drivers/ata/pata_hpt3x2n.c | 8 +++++---
drivers/ata/pata_isapnp.c | 2 ++
drivers/ata/sata_mv.c | 3 +++
7 files changed, 42 insertions(+), 21 deletions(-)

Alan Cox (1):
sata_mv: PCI IDs for Hightpoint RocketRaid 1740/1742

Bartlomiej Zolnierkiewicz (1):
pata_artop: fix UDMA5 for AEC6280[R] and UDMA6 for AEC6880[R]

Jeff Garzik (1):
[libata] pata_isapnp: replace missing module device table

Ryan Power (1):
libata: adjust libata to ignore errors after spinup

Sergei Shtylyov (2):
pata_hpt37x: actually clock HPT374 with 50 MHz DPLL (take 2)
pata_hpt{37x|3x2n}: fix clock reporting (take 2)

Tejun Heo (2):
ata_piix: update map 10b for ich8m
ata_piix: add TECRA M7 to broken suspend list
